A comprehensive chimney cleaning in Washington, D.C., involves more than just sweeping; it's a detailed assessment of the entire system. This includes the flue liner, firebox, damper, smoke chamber, and exterior masonry. Licensed pros use specialized tools to meticulously remove creosote, soot, and any blockages, which are the primary causes of chimney fires. They also perform visual inspections to detect cracks, loose mortar, or other damage that could lead to further problems or safety hazards. The final cost for your chimney service depends on a few specific factors. We look at the total height of the chimney stack, the level of creosote buildup inside the flue, and whether you have a standard masonry fireplace or a prefabricated metal insert. If there are structural blockages like nests or excessive debris that require extra labor, that will also adjust the estimate. We avoid hidden fees, but every setup is unique, so we evaluate the condition of your liner and firebox upon inspection.

In Washington, D.C., it is generally recommended to have a chimney sweep service performed annually. This frequency ensures the removal of creosote and soot buildup that can occur with regular use of your fireplace or wood-burning stove. The precise need for cleaning can depend on usage patterns and the type of fuel burned. Signs of a dirty chimney in Washington, D.C., include soot falling into the fireplace, a distinct smoky odor when the fireplace isn't in use, or difficulty starting and maintaining a fire. You might also notice excessive smoke entering the room instead of going up the chimney, or visible creosote on the interior walls of the flue.
